Market Size and Trends
The Telemedicine Software market is estimated to be valued at USD 15.2 billion in 2025 and is expected to reach USD 39.7 billion by 2032, growing at a compound annual growth rate (CAGR) of 14.3% from 2024 to 2031. This substantial growth reflects increasing adoption of digital healthcare solutions, driven by technological advancements and rising demand for remote patient monitoring and consultation services across the globe.
A key trend shaping the Telemedicine Software market is the integration of artificial intelligence and machine learning to enhance diagnostic accuracy and patient engagement. Additionally, expanding internet penetration and smartphone usage are facilitating easier access to telehealth services. Healthcare providers are increasingly leveraging telemedicine to reduce operational costs and improve care delivery, particularly in rural and underserved areas, further propelling market expansion and innovation.
Segmental Analysis:
By Platform Type: Dominance of Web-Based Solutions Through Accessibility and Flexibility
In terms of By Platform Type, Web-based contributes the highest share of the market owning to its inherent accessibility and ease of deployment. Web-based telemedicine software allows healthcare providers and patients to connect via internet browsers without the need for complex installations or specific device requirements, making it highly convenient and scalable across different healthcare settings. This platform type is particularly favored in outpatient, ambulatory, and remote patient interaction scenarios because it supports real-time communication with minimal technical barriers. Additionally, the increasing penetration of high-speed internet and improved bandwidth availability globally further supports the growth of web-based telemedicine platforms. Another significant driver is the growing demand for cross-platform compatibility; web-based solutions operate seamlessly across multiple operating systems and devices, including desktops, tablets, and smartphones, facilitating integration into existing healthcare workflows. Healthcare providers also appreciate the continuous updates and ease of maintenance associated with web-based software, reducing the burden on internal IT departments. Furthermore, regulatory support in various countries to allow the use of telemedicine during public health emergencies has accelerated adoption of web-based platforms due to their rapid deployment capabilities. Overall, the combination of convenience, scalability, and enhanced user experience positions web-based telemedicine software as the leading platform segment in the market.
By Component: Software Segment Thrives Driven by Comprehensive Functional Capabilities
By Component, Software contributes the highest share of the market, mainly due to its role as the core enabler of telemedicine services. The software component integrates critical functionalities such as video conferencing, electronic health records (EHR) integration, appointment scheduling, and secure data transmission, creating an all-encompassing platform that caters to diverse clinical needs. The rapid advancement in telecommunication technologies and the integration of AI and machine learning within software modules have expanded the capabilities of telemedicine offerings, making them more intuitive and supportive for diagnostic and therapeutic processes. Additionally, software solutions optimize clinical workflows by automating routine tasks, enabling better patient management, and facilitating seamless communication between healthcare providers and patients. The flexibility of software-based systems supports customizability for providers, allowing the incorporation of specialty-specific modules and compliance with regional healthcare regulations. Furthermore, the growing emphasis on data security and HIPAA-compliant solutions drives demand for sophisticated software that ensures encrypted, private communication. While services such as integration and support play a complementary role, the foundational software itself remains the primary growth driver by consistently evolving and enabling broader applications in telehealth. This positioning underscores why software dominates the component segmentation in telemedicine software markets.
By Application: Chronic Disease Management Leading Due to Rising Prevalence and Continuous Monitoring Needs
By Application, Chronic Disease Management holds the highest market share, reflecting the urgent need for continuous care and monitoring of patients with long-term conditions. Chronic diseases such as diabetes, cardiovascular disorders, respiratory illnesses, and hypertension require regular patient-provider interaction and frequent health assessments, which are effectively facilitated via telemedicine platforms. These software solutions allow for real-time remote monitoring through connected devices, enabling timely interventions and reducing the necessity for hospital visits. The increasing global prevalence of chronic diseases, driven by aging populations and lifestyle changes, has put sustained pressure on healthcare systems, making telemedicine a vital component in managing healthcare delivery efficiently. Additionally, chronic disease management platforms often incorporate patient education, medication adherence tracking, and personalized care plans, which enhance patient engagement and promote better health outcomes. The convenience and cost-effectiveness of remote monitoring appeal to both patients and providers, fostering greater adoption of telemedicine in this application area. Mental health and acute care segments, while growing, often face complexity in emergency interventions or face-to-face therapy preferences, making chronic care more adaptable to digital health solutions. Collectively, these factors solidify chronic disease management as the leading application segment within the telemedicine software domain.
Regional Insights:
Dominating Region: North America
In North America, the dominance in the Telemedicine Software market is driven by a highly advanced healthcare ecosystem, widespread adoption of digital health technologies, and strong governmental support. The presence of a robust network of healthcare providers, insurance companies, and technology firms creates a conducive environment for telemedicine innovations. Regulatory frameworks such as the Health Insurance Portability and Accountability Act (HIPAA) in the U.S. provide secure conditions for patient data exchange, encouraging telemedicine adoption. Moreover, the U.S. government and key states have implemented favorable reimbursement policies, expanding telehealth services' accessibility. Prominent companies such as Teladoc Health, Amwell, and MDLIVE have pioneered integrated telemedicine platforms offering comprehensive virtual care. Their focus on interoperability and AI-driven diagnostics has further enhanced North America's lead in this sector.
Fastest-Growing Region: Asia Pacific
Meanwhile, the Asia Pacific exhibits the fastest growth in the telemedicine software market, fueled by increasing smartphone penetration, expanding internet infrastructure, and rising demand for accessible healthcare amid a large and diverse population. Countries in this region, notably China, India, and Southeast Asian nations, are aggressively pursuing digital health initiatives supported by government policies aimed at improving rural healthcare access. This growth is also supported by a vibrant startup ecosystem and collaborations between global tech giants and local enterprises. Companies such as Ping An Good Doctor in China, Practo in India, and Halodoc in Indonesia are instrumental in driving substantial innovation and market expansion through user-friendly applications and AI-powered symptom checkers. Trade dynamics reflecting increased foreign investments and technology transfer also accelerate the regional uptake of telemedicine solutions.
Telemedicine Software Market Outlook for Key Countries
United States
The United States' market is highly mature, characterized by extensive integration of telemedicine into mainstream healthcare delivery. Leading players like Teladoc Health and Amwell dominate through broad platform offerings that include virtual consultations, remote patient monitoring, and mental health services. The U.S. government's proactive stance on telehealth reimbursement and relaxed regulations during healthcare emergencies has propelled deeper market penetration. The competitive landscape is marked by continuous product innovation and strong partnerships with hospital systems.
China
China's market is rapidly evolving, supported by significant government initiatives promoting "Internet Plus Healthcare" to enhance healthcare accessibility. Companies like Ping An Good Doctor and WeDoctor are leveraging AI and big data analytics to develop scalable telemedicine services that cater to urban and rural populations alike. The local market benefits from extensive internet infrastructure investments and a growing aging population demanding chronic disease management solutions. Furthermore, collaborations with international technology firms support the ongoing development of sophisticated software platforms.
India
India's telemedicine landscape is marked by an expanding digital infrastructure and government policies such as the National Digital Health Mission, which promotes interoperability and digitization of health records. Practo and mfine are among the key market players, offering platforms that combine teleconsultation with e-pharmacy and diagnostics. The country's vast rural population drives demand for affordable and easily accessible healthcare solutions, prompting innovation in low-cost mobile-based telemedicine applications.
Germany
Germany maintains a strong presence in the European telemedicine market, with a healthcare system keen on integrating digital health tools. The DVG (Digital Healthcare Act) supports reimbursement for digital health applications, encouraging innovation from companies like Compugroup Medical and Doctolib. German telemedicine solutions focus on data privacy, seamless integration with electronic health records, and specialty-specific platforms, reflecting the country's emphasis on quality and regulatory compliance.
Brazil
Brazil represents a vital market in Latin America, supported by expanding internet access and the government's push for digital health initiatives amid a strained public healthcare system. Key players such as Dr. Consulta and Conexa Saúde offer telemedicine solutions tailored to urban and semi-urban populations. The market dynamics are influenced by efforts to normalize virtual healthcare financing and increased collaboration between private providers and the public health sector.
